SHENZHEN, China — Hurricane Ragasa, one of many strongest in years, whipped waves taller than lampposts onto Hong Kong promenades and turned seas tough on the southern Chinese language coast on Wednesday after leaving lethal destruction in Taiwan and the Philippines.

In Taiwan, 14 folks died in a flooded township, and 10 deaths had been reported within the Philippines.

Almost 1.9 million folks had been relocated throughout Guangdong province, the southern Chinese language financial powerhouse. A climate station in Chuandao city recorded most gusts of 241 kph (about 150 mph) at midday, a excessive in Jiangmen metropolis since record-keeping started. Big waves battered Zhuhai metropolis’s shoreline and powerful winds buffered bushes beneath intense rain. Fallen branches had been scattered on the streets.

The nationwide climate company forecast the extreme hurricane would make landfall between the cities of Yangjiang and Zhanjiang on Wednesday night. Colleges, factories and transportation companies had been suspended in a couple of dozen cities.

The fierce winds, introduced by Ragasa, as soon as an excellent hurricane, woke Hong Kong residents within the early hours, and lots of went on-line to explain scenes like a kitchen air flow fan being blown down and a crane swaying.

Robust winds blew away elements of a pedestrian bridge’s roof and knocked down lots of of bushes throughout town. A vessel crashed into the shore, shattering a row of glass railings alongside the waterfront. Areas round some rivers and promenades had been flooded, together with biking lanes and playgrounds. At a number of promenade eating places, furnishings was scattered chaotically by the winds. Over 60 injured folks had been handled at hospitals.

A video that confirmed waves of water crashing by the doorways of a lodge and flooding its interiors went viral within the monetary hub. The lodge has not instantly commented on the incident. However workers had been seen cleansing up the foyer, with elements of its exterior broken.

Hong Kong and Macao, a close-by on line casino hub, canceled faculties and flights, with many retailers closed. A whole lot of individuals sought refuge in non permanent facilities in every metropolis. Streets in Macao became streams with numerous particles floating on the water. Rescue crews deployed inflatable boats to save lots of those that had been trapped. The playing metropolis’s native electrical energy provider suspended its energy provide in some flooded, low-lying areas for security.

As winds step by step weakened within the afternoon, a couple of cities distant from the anticipated landfall location had been making ready to renew regular operations.

Hong Kong’s observatory mentioned Ragasa had most sustained winds close to the middle of about 195 kph (120 mph) and skirted round 100 kilometers (62 miles) to the south of the monetary hub. The town categorizes cyclones with sustained winds 185 kph or stronger as tremendous typhoons to make residents further vigilant about intense storms.

The observatory mentioned Ragasa is the strongest tropical cyclone within the northwestern Pacific and South China Sea area to this point this yr. Preliminary evaluation confirmed it additionally ranks because the second-strongest one within the South China Sea area for the reason that observatory’s record-keeping started in 1950, tying with typhoons Saola in 2023 and Yagi in 2024, it mentioned.

Ragasa earlier precipitated deaths and harm in Taiwan and the Philippines after the hurricane took a path between them.

In Taiwan, heavy rain precipitated a barrier lake in Hualien County to overflow Tuesday and torrents of muddy water destroyed a bridge, turning roads in Guangfu township into churning rivers that carried automobiles and furnishings away. Guangfu has about 8,450 folks, greater than half of whom sought security on greater flooring of their houses or on greater floor. Native authorities mentioned 14 folks died and speak to was misplaced with 124 others within the township. Taiwan’s Central Information Company mentioned rescuers had been going door-to-door to examine on these residents.

Individually, 34 folks had been injured throughout the self-ruled island.

At the very least 10 deaths had been reported within the Philippines, together with seven fishermen who drowned after their boat was battered by enormous waves and fierce wind and flipped over on Monday off Santa Ana city in northern Cagayan province. 5 different fishermen remained lacking, provincial officers mentioned.

Almost 700,000 folks had been affected by the onslaught in the primary northern Philippine area of Luzon, together with 25,000 individuals who who fled to authorities emergency shelters.
